
New details about the upcoming vivo X500 Pro Max have surfaced online, revealing major upgrades in its rear camera system. The leak arrives shortly after earlier reports shared information about the device’s display, adding more clarity to its flagship-level specifications.
Triple Rear Camera Setup Confirmed
According to the latest leak, the vivo X500 Pro Max will feature a triple rear camera system. The setup is expected to include two 50MP sensors along with a high-resolution 200MP camera, making it one of the most advanced imaging setups in the series.
50MP Sony Primary Sensor
The main camera is tipped to use a 50MP Sony 1/1.28-inch LOFIC sensor. This sensor is designed to enhance dynamic range and improve low-light photography, helping the device capture more detailed and balanced images in challenging lighting conditions.
200MP Periscope Telephoto Camera
The standout feature of the system is the periscope telephoto lens, which may come with a 200MP 1/1.4-inch sensor. This camera is expected to significantly improve zoom quality while maintaining sharpness and clarity at long distances.
Upgraded Ultrawide Camera in Testing
For ultrawide shots, vivo is reportedly testing a 50MP Sony IMX8-series sensor. However, the company is also considering a smaller 50MP alternative, meaning final specifications may still change before launch.
Expected Launch Timeline
The vivo X500 series is rumored to debut in September and could include four different models. This suggests a broad lineup aimed at different price and performance segments.
Possible Chipset Upgrade
Earlier leaks also indicate that the X500 Pro Max may be powered by MediaTek’s upcoming Dimensity 9600 chipset. If true, this would position the device as a high-end flagship focused on both performance and camera innovation.
